Strange cistern fill

Normally when the toilet is flushed it would re-fill in say a half minute and you could hear the cistern filling, now its like it fills in short bursts almost like a tap is being turned and then off, it does this about 7 times until the valve cuts it off when filled.

Any ideas what would cause this, its just recently started doing this. No other water is being used at the same time ie dishwasher or washing machine.
